Drive Data Types
The table below lists data types that are supported or unsupported for Drive recovery in IBM® Storage Protect for Cloud Google Workspace.
| Data Types | Support Status | Comments | |
|---|---|---|---|
| User’s drive | Priority | Unsupported | |
| Recent | Unsupported | ||
| Starred | Unsupported | ||
| Trash | Supported | Supports backup and restore when the Trash folder is selected in Backup Settings. | |
| Computer | Unsupported | ||
| Folder | Owner | Supported | |
| Description | Supported | ||
| Created time | Unsupported | After the restore, the folder’s created time will be updated to the restored time. | |
| Modified | Partially Supported | Does not support restoring the last modifying user. | |
| Opened | Unsupported | ||
| Share with people and groups | Supported | ||
| Get link | Partially Supported | If the original folder has been deleted, after the restore, the original shared link will be unavailable. The resolution is getting a new shared link to the restored folder. | |
| If you removed the target audience with who a folder was shared with, after the restore job is Finished, the target audience would be restored as a group, but this security change cannot be reported in job details due to Google API limitations. | |||
| Color | Supported | ||
| Added to Starred/Removed from Starred | Supported | ||
| File (includes documents, images, audio, and videos) | Share with people and groups | Supported | |
| Get link | Partially Supported | If the original file has been deleted, after the restore, the original shared link will be unavailable. The resolution is getting a new shared link of the restored file. | |
| If you removed the target audience with whom a file was shared with, after the restore job is Finished, the target audience would be restored as a group, but this security change cannot be reported in job details due to Google API limitations. | |||
| Added to Starred/Removed from Starred | Supported | ||
| Description | Supported | ||
| Owner | Supported | ||
| Labels | Supported | ||
| Created time | Unsupported | After the restore, the folder’s created time will be updated to the restored time. | |
| Modified | Partially Supported | Does not support restoring the last modifying user. | |
| Opened | Unsupported | ||
| Version History | Unsupported | ||
| File (includes documents, images, audios, and videos) | Google Docs | Supported |
The format of comments and replies cannot be kept in the restored file. For Google Docs, Google Sheets, and Google Slides, the add-ons cannot be kept after the restore due to Google API limitations. You can manually insert add-ons after the restore. |
| Google Sheets | |||
| Google Slides | |||
| Google Vids | Supported | ||
| Google Forms | Unsupported | ||
| Google Drawings | Unsupported | ||
| Google My Maps | Unsupported | ||
| Google Sites | Unsupported | ||
| Google App Scripts | Supported | ||
| Google Jamboards' | Unsupported | ||
| Shortcuts | Unsupported | ||
| Shortcuts of third-party apps | Unsupported | ||
| Files identified as malware or spam | Unsupported | ||
| Files which the current user has no permission to download or export | Unsupported | ||
